How Do You Like Your Steak: Rare, Medium, or Well-Done? Knife and Soul Kitchen

Knife and Soul explores the culture around perfect steak, from neighborhood diners to high end steakhouses. When you sit down, the question is simple, do you like your steak rare medium or well done.

Each level of doneness shapes flavor, texture, and even how the staff describe the experience. Understanding these styles helps you communicate clearly and get exactly what you crave.

Doneness Internal Temperature Color and Texture Best Cuts and Pairings
Rare 50 to 52°C Deep red center, cool pink rim Tenderloins, Ribeyes, Napa cabbage salad
Medium Rare 55 to 57°C Warm red center, soft pink outer ring Striploin, Filet Mignon, roasted garlic potatoes
Medium 60 to 63°C Pink core, light brown edges Chuck steaks, flat iron, grilled asparagus
Well Done 71°C+ Uniform brown, firm surface Thicker flank or brisket, bold chimichurri

How Knife and Soul Defines Rare Steak

At Knife and Soul, rare is about bright juice and a soft, almost melt in your mouth bite. The kitchen aims for precise temperature control to protect that vivid red center.

Chefs often use quick high heat searing to build flavor while minimizing cook time. Guests who prefer rare get a plate that feels indulgent yet clean.

Sourcing and Aging Practices

Many locations partner with trusted farms that provide consistent marbling. Dry aging can deepen flavor and improve tenderness, making the rare experience more vibrant.

Medium Steak as the Sweet Spot

Medium strikes a balance between juicy tenderness and approachable safety. It preserves enough pink while reducing the chew associated with rare cuts.

This level is popular for date nights and group meals where some guests want richness and others want a firmer bite.

Flavor Development and Caramelization

With medium doneness, searing creates more fond and richer pan sauces. The interplay between crust and interior gives Knife and Soul dishes memorable complexity.

Well Done Preferences and Customization

Well done steaks at Knife and Soul focus on edge to edge consistency. Diners who enjoy firm, hearty textures find satisfaction in slower cooked preparations.

Kitchens may slice against the grain or finish with sauce to preserve juiciness for guests who would otherwise avoid dryness.

FAQ

Reader questions

Does rare steak at Knife and Soul carry any food safety concerns?

Reputable Knife and Soul locations source inspected meat and monitor internal temperatures closely. Diners with weaker immune systems may still prefer higher levels of doneness.

Can I ask for my steak temperature in between the listed levels?

Yes, most servers will note mid levels such as medium rare plus or medium minus. The kitchen can usually adjust cook time to match your exact preference.

Which cut works best when I want rare versus well done?

Tenderloins and ribeyes shine in rare preparations, while chuck, flank, or brisket hold structure better at well done levels.

How does the staff communicate doneness to the kitchen?

Clear verbal cues, sometimes paired with temperature charts, help the line cook nail rare, medium, or well done expectations consistently.
